FSC Kindrogan is set in wooded grounds on the banks of the River Ardle, and is a gateway to the picturesque Scottish Highlands. It lies within easy reach of some of the remotest areas of the UK with inspiring landforms and rich range of wildlife habitats but is just one and a half hours travel from Glasgow or Edinburgh.

Perth is situated on the east side of Scotland. It is an area of deep historical interest as many Scottish Kings were crowned on the Stone of destiny at Scone Palace. There are many fun-filled outdoor activities for students in the area including wildlife parks, indoor play centres and field centres, and especially concentrating on watersports.
You can learn about animals at the Highland Wildlife Park, the history of Scotland's clans at the grandest Glen, Glencoe or Scotland's history of fighting the English at Killiecrankie. An often-missed gem is the village of Dunkeld, frozen in time and preserved by the National Trust for Scotland.

Police in Iceland are investigating after a British schoolgirl was slapped and chased by a tour guide in a hotel corridor.
The schoolgirl, 13, who attended Harris Girls’ Academy, was assaulted whilst on a school trip to Iceland to see the Northern Lights. The incident occurred at Hotel Örk, Hveragerdi on 13th October.
